Two men who pleaded guilty to 5 counts of robbery were handed partial suspended sentences by the Suva High Court this morning.

The court heard that between the 3rd and 4th of September this year, Timoci Tukana and Apisalome Nakulinivalu robbed 3 victims using the same method.

They snatched the bags of the victims and ran away.

High Court Judge Justice Daniel Goundar sentenced Tukana to 2 years imprisonment for three counts of robbery, 12 months to be served in prison while the remaining term was suspended for two years.

Nakulinivalu was sentenced to two years imprisonment, 9 months to be served in prison while the remaining term was suspended for two years.
